KIAC WBB Player of the Week: Catie Fletcher (Asbury)
FLORENCE, Ky. -- Asbury (Ky.) University senior guard Catie Fletcher posted 22 points per game in two victories last week to earn KIAC Women's Basketball Player of the Week honors for Jan. 11-18.
The 5-10 senior from Versailles, Ky., led her team in scoring to keep Asbury in first place in the KIAC Capital Division at 11-8 overall and 7-1 KIAC. She put up 23 points on 9 of 13 shooting in just 17 minute and 25 seconds of playing time in a 103-50 win over Cincinnati Christian.
Fletcher then tallied 21 points and eight rebounds in 25 minutes of action in an 87-57 win over IU Kokomo. She made 8 of 14 field goals that game to shoot 63 percent (17 of 27) for the week.
It was a very hot week from the perimeter for Fletcher, who made 5 of 6 treys versus CCU and 3 of 4 versus IU Kokomo for 8-for-10 shooting on the week. She is fifth in the KIAC in scoring at 16.74 ppg and is third in the conference in 3-point accuracy at 41 percent.
